Shinjuku

One of Tokyo's most famous wards has world-class shopping and entertainment options galore.

Ginza

Named after a silver-coin mint, this district has a long association with affluence. Today it’s where you’ll find some of Japan’s most upmarket labels, restaurants and galleries.

Asakusa

Follow the footsteps of centuries of worshippers along a street filled with traditional snack stalls and through the gates of one of Tokyo’s most popular temples.

Ueno

Try the hanami tradition of admiring flowers as you walk past cherry blossoms and delve into the history of this area through its museums and ornate temples.

Maihama

This small area, located in Urayasu just outside of Tokyo, is best known as the gateway to Japan’s wildly popular Tokyo Disney Resort.

  • Shibuya Crossing: Experience the iconic Shibuya Crossing, renowned as one of the busiest pedestrian crossings in the world. This vibrant area buzzes with energy, offering a unique blend of family-friendly activities and outdoor vibes. Witness the stunning sight of hundreds of people crossing simultaneously, creating a captivating urban spectacle.
  • Tokyo Tower: Standing tall at 4.8km from Shibuya, Tokyo Tower is a modern architectural marvel that offers panoramic views of the city. Its bright orange and white structure is reminiscent of the Eiffel Tower, making it a must-visit for those seeking an impressive cityscape and a taste of modern Japan.
  • Tokyo Imperial Palace: Located 4.8km from Shibuya, the Tokyo Imperial Palace is a historic site that embodies Japan's rich culture and heritage. Surrounded by beautiful gardens and moats, it provides a serene escape from the bustling city, allowing visitors to appreciate its stunning architecture and tranquil atmosphere.

How can I get around Shibuya and the greater Tokyo area?

If you want to see more of the city, Shibuya Station is the closest metro stop. Others nearby include Meiji-jingumae 'Harajuku' Station and Yoyogi-koen Station. If you're considering venturing out of town, train travel is a great option. Harajuku Station is the closest train station, but Shinsen Station and Yoyogi-Hachiman Station are also close by.
